H2: The History of TNT: From Dye to Demolition

TNT, or trinitrotoluene, wasn't initially developed as an explosive. Its origins lie in the late 19th century, where it was explored as a yellow dye. However, its explosive properties quickly became apparent, leading to its adoption as a military explosive during World War I. Its relative safety in handling compared to other explosives of the time, coupled with its powerful detonation, solidified its place in history. H2: Properties of TNT: What Makes it so Powerful?

TNT's power stems from its chemical structure. The three nitro groups attached to the toluene molecule are responsible for its instability and explosive potential. When detonated, these nitro groups rapidly release energy, causing a powerful shockwave. Its melting point is relatively low, making it easy to melt and cast into various shapes for different applications, adding to its versatility. This means it can be easily molded into shells and other munitions.

H2: Legal Uses of TNT: Beyond Warfare

While widely associated with warfare, TNT has legitimate and crucial applications. It's used in:

  • Demolition: Controlled demolitions of buildings, bridges, and other structures.
  • Mining: Breaking up large rock formations in mining operations.
  • Quarrying: Extracting stone and other materials from quarries.
  • Scientific Research: Used in specialized laboratory experiments.

The controlled use of TNT in these industries requires strict adherence to safety regulations and expert handling.

H2: The Science Behind the Boom: A Simple Explanation

The explosion of TNT involves a rapid exothermic reaction, releasing a tremendous amount of energy in the form of heat and pressure. This process produces a large volume of gases, creating the characteristic shockwave that causes the destructive force. The exact chemical reactions are complex, but the fundamental principle involves the rapid breaking and reforming of chemical bonds.

H2: Mythbusters: Debunking Common TNT Misconceptions

Several myths surround TNT. Let's address a few common misconceptions:

  • Myth: TNT always explodes instantly upon contact with a flame. Fact: TNT requires a powerful detonation to initiate its explosion; a simple flame will not cause detonation.
  • Myth: TNT is highly unstable and prone to accidental detonation. Fact: While powerful, TNT is relatively stable compared to other explosives under normal conditions.
  • Myth: TNT is easily accessible to the public. Fact: TNT is a strictly controlled substance and its acquisition requires extensive permits and security measures.
